Peppered Ham
- add review
- #103932
2-5 hrs
ingredients
4 pounds fully cooked, boneless ham
1/4 cup honey
2 tablespoons prepared mustard
1 clove garlic, minced
3 tablespoons coarse ground black pepper
1/8 teaspoon ground cloves
directions
Preheat oven to 325 degrees F. Place ham on a rack in a shallow roasting pan.
In a small bowl, combine honey, mustard, garlic, pepper and cloves. Brush honey mixture over ham. Loosely cover ham with foil.
Bake for 1 3/4 to 2 1/4 hours or until heated through. Serve warm.
